Meander around the lovely hilltop neighborhood of Cerro Concepcion and enjoy sweeping views over Valparaiso's shorefront. Springing forth from the ruins of the city's old walls, the neighborhood quickly found its own bohemian, quirky character, which persists to this day. Colorful houses line the narrow streets, occasionally interrupted by equally vibrant street art. Hang out with Valparaiso's coolest crowd at one of the area's trendy coffee shops, or hunt for the perfect souvenir among the quaint handicraft shops. Absolutely fantastic neighborhood where every single twist and turn leads to absolutely amazing scenery. From the beautiful and meticulously painted start art to the painted fronts of residential buildings and the lovely shops scattered throughout the area. This place is a must see in the port city. All located within the historic quarter and designated as a UNESCO world heritage site which ensures this place remains beautiful for many years to come.
